Out of the Blue

1980
A rebellious teenage girl struggles to find meaning in a broken world after her father’s release from prison. Linda Manz delivers a raw, unforgettable performance as a punk-loving outsider adrift in small-town despair, while director-star Dennis Hopper portrays her troubled father. With Sharon Farrell as the fragile mother caught in the cycle, Out of the Blue is a haunting, uncompromising drama that became a cult classic for its unflinching portrait of alienation.

Dreams on Spec

2007
"Dreams on Spec" takes an intimate look at how far people will go - and how much they will sacrifice - for the chance to pursue their dreams. This feature-length documentary delves into the lives of three aspiring Hollywood screenwriters as they pour their hearts into their spec scripts, pitch their ideas to anyone who will listen, go to meetings, hold table reads, and work at low-level day-jobs - all in the hopes of one day seeing one of their beloved creations made into a movie. These poignant portraits are intercut with wisdom from a "Greek Chorus" of superstar Hollywood creative-types like James L. Brooks, Nora Ephron, Gary Ross, and Carrie Fisher to forge a funny and compelling look at inspiration, creativity, and solitude in the movie industry.
